Singer Eartha Kitt dies aged 81 from cancer
US singer and actress Eartha Kitt has died at the aged 81 after suffering from colon cancer.

Kitt’s publicist Andrew Freedman has revealed that she died on Thursday.

Eartha KittKitt, who was famous for her distinctive voice and who lived in the American state of Connecticut, had several hits, including Old Fashioned Girl, C'est Si Bon and Santa Baby.

Kitt first appeared as an actress in a number of 1950s films.

She was nominated in the Tony, Grammy and Emmy award categories, as well as having played the role of Catwoman in the Batman television series in the 1960s.

Kitt was a great success on New York's Broadway in the 1978 production, Timbuktu! and from the 1980s and onwards she had roles in many films.

In 1984, she scored another hit with Where Is My Man?

Kitt found her way onto the path to stardom, when aged just 16, she was taken on as a dancer with a professional troupe touring Europe, and this led to her appearing later on in Paris nightclubs.

Kitt had one daughter from a marriage in the 1960s that was short-lived.
